400-680-8581
欢迎访问:路由通
中国IT知识门户
位置:路由通 > 资讯中心 > excel > 文章详情

为什么access导入不了excel

作者:路由通
|
364人看过
发布时间:2025-09-22 06:45:36
标签:
Access数据库导入Excel文件失败是常见问题,原因多样,包括文件格式不兼容、数据损坏、版本差异、权限限制等。本文深入分析12个核心原因,每个配真实案例,帮助用户快速排查并解决导入障碍,提升工作效率。
为什么access导入不了excel

       在日常办公中,许多用户遇到Access数据库无法成功导入Excel文件的情况,这可能导致数据整合延误或错误。本文将系统性地探讨导致这一问题的多种原因,并提供实用解决方案。每个论点均基于实际场景和权威技术文档,确保内容的专业性和可靠性。文章结构清晰,便于读者按图索骥地诊断问题。

文件格式不兼容

       Access和Excel的文件格式可能存在兼容性问题,尤其是当Excel文件使用较新的格式(如.xlsx),而Access版本较旧时。例如,Access 2003仅支持.xls格式,如果用户尝试导入.xlsx文件,系统会报错“无法识别文件类型”。另一个案例是,某企业使用Access 2010导入Excel 2016创建的文件,由于格式升级,导入过程失败,需先将Excel另存为兼容模式。

Excel文件损坏

       文件损坏是常见原因,可能由于存储介质问题、意外关闭或病毒攻击导致。案例一:用户从网络共享盘中下载Excel文件后导入Access,但文件部分数据区块损坏,导入时出现“数据读取错误”。案例二:一名财务人员尝试导入月度报表,但因Excel文件在传输过程中受损,Access显示“无效文件格式”,需使用Excel的修复工具先恢复文件。

Access版本过低

       低版本Access可能不支持新特性或文件格式,导致导入失败。案例:某公司使用Access 2007,但Excel文件包含高级数据模型,导入时Access无法处理,错误提示为“功能不受支持”。另一案例是,用户升级到Office 365后,旧版Access无法导入新Excel的加密功能,需升级Access版本以保持兼容。

权限不足

       操作系统或文件系统的权限设置可能阻止Access读取Excel文件。案例一:用户以标准用户身份运行Access,但Excel文件位于受保护的系统目录,导入时出现“访问被拒绝”错误。案例二:在企业环境中,网络驱动器上的Excel文件设置了只读权限,导致Access无法写入临时数据,需调整文件属性或使用管理员权限运行Access。

数据类型冲突

       Excel和Access的数据类型(如文本、数字、日期)可能不匹配,引发导入错误。案例:Excel列中包含混合类型(如数字和文本),Access尝试统一类型时失败,显示“数据类型不匹配”。另一案例是,日期格式在Excel中为“YYYY-MM-DD”,但Access期望“MM/DD/YYYY”,导入后数据混乱,需在导入前标准化Excel数据。

字段名称重复

       如果Excel中的列名与Access表字段名重复或包含非法字符,会导致冲突。案例一:用户导入Excel文件时,列名“ID”与Access保留字冲突,系统报错“无效字段名称”。案例二:Excel列名包含空格(如“Sales Data”),Access将其视为两个字段,导入失败,需重命名列以避免特殊字符。

文件路径错误

       文件路径过长、包含特殊字符或网络路径不稳定,都可能阻碍导入。案例:用户尝试导入位于深层文件夹的Excel文件,路径超过Windows限制,Access无法访问。另一案例是,网络驱动器断开连接时导入,出现“文件未找到”错误,需确保路径简短且网络稳定。

安全软件阻止

       防病毒或防火墙软件可能误判导入操作为威胁,从而拦截。案例一:某杀毒软件将Access导入过程标记为可疑行为,自动阻止文件读取。案例二:企业防火墙设置限制外部数据导入,用户需临时禁用安全软件或添加例外规则,才能成功导入。

系统资源不足

       内存或磁盘空间不足时,Access可能无法处理大型Excel文件。案例:用户导入100MB的Excel文件,但系统内存仅4GB,导致Access崩溃。另一案例是,磁盘空间满,无法创建临时文件,导入中止,需释放资源或优化文件大小。

网络连接问题

       对于网络共享的Excel文件,连接不稳定或权限问题会引发导入失败。案例:从云存储下载Excel文件时网络中断,导入过程超时。案例二:VPN连接不稳定,导致Access无法持续访问远程文件,需检查网络设置或使用本地副本。

包含宏或公式

       Excel中的宏或复杂公式可能不被Access支持,导致导入错误。案例一:用户导入带VBA宏的Excel文件,Access忽略宏但数据格式出错。案例二:公式计算结果在导入时被误处理,如动态数组公式无法转换,需在Excel中先将公式转换为值再导入。

导入向导错误

       Access导入向导的设置错误,如错误选择数据类型或分隔符,会导致失败。案例:用户误将文本文件格式应用于Excel导入,数据解析混乱。另一案例是,分隔符设置不匹配(如Excel使用逗号,但Access设为制表符),导入后数据错位,需仔细配置向导选项。

操作系统不兼容

       不同操作系统(如Windows与Mac)的文件系统差异可能影响导入。案例:在Mac版Office中创建的Excel文件,在Windows Access中导入时权限或格式问题。案例二:32位与64位系统组件不匹配,导致Access驱动无法识别Excel文件,需确保系统环境一致。

文件过大

       Excel文件大小超过Access处理限制时,导入会失败。案例:用户尝试导入500MB的Excel文件,但Access有行数或大小限制,报错“数据过多”。另一案例是,历史数据累积导致文件膨胀,需拆分Excel文件或使用数据库优化工具。

字符编码不一致

       Excel和Access的字符编码(如UTF-8与ANSI)不匹配,会造成乱码或导入中断。案例:多语言数据在Excel中以UTF-8保存,但Access默认ANSI编码,导入后中文显示为乱码。案例二:特殊字符(如emoji)不被支持,需在导入前转换编码格式。

       总之,Access导入Excel失败涉及多方面因素,从文件本身到系统环境都可能产生影响。通过逐一排查上述原因,用户可以有效解决问题,确保数据流畅导入。建议定期更新软件、备份文件,并参考官方文档以预防类似问题。

Access导入Excel失败通常源于格式、权限、资源或设置问题,本文详细解析15个核心原因及案例,帮助用户诊断和解决。保持软件兼容性、优化文件处理可提升成功率,避免数据丢失。
相关文章
为什么创建excel表失败
创建Excel表格失败的原因涉及数据输入、公式错误、格式设置等多个方面。本文将基于微软官方文档,详细解析12个常见失败点,每个论点辅以真实案例,帮助用户识别并避免陷阱,提升表格创建成功率。内容专业实用,旨在提供深度指导。
2025-09-22 06:45:34
320人看过
为什么excel降序排序出错
Excel降序排序功能看似简单,却隐藏着许多容易忽视的陷阱。本文系统梳理了12个常见错误原因,从数据格式到系统设置,每个问题都配有实际案例说明,帮助用户彻底解决排序异常问题。
2025-09-22 06:44:49
240人看过
excel为什么不能执行公式
Excel公式无法执行是用户常遇到的问题,可能由于语法错误、引用无效、设置不当等原因导致。本文将系统解析15个核心原因,每个配备实际案例和解决方案,帮助用户深入理解并快速解决公式失效问题,提升数据处理效率。
2025-09-22 06:44:44
72人看过
pt是什么单位word
本文全面解析了pt单位在Microsoft Word中的应用,从定义、历史到实际使用技巧,涵盖12个核心论点。通过引用官方资料和真实案例,帮助用户深入理解pt单位在文档排版中的重要性,并提供实用建议以优化工作效率。
2025-09-22 06:43:32
320人看过
为什么word不能批注
本文深入分析了Microsoft Word中批注功能可能无法使用的多种原因,涵盖了软件版本、文件格式、用户权限、系统兼容性等核心因素。通过引用官方资料和真实案例,提供详尽解释和实用解决方案,帮助用户全面理解并解决批注障碍。
2025-09-22 06:43:05
46人看过
为什么word会被锁住
为什么Word文档会被锁住?本文详细分析了文档被锁的多种原因,包括权限设置、软件冲突、病毒影响等,结合官方案例和实用解决方案,帮助用户全面理解并有效应对这一问题。
2025-09-22 06:43:00
312人看过